Why is Cyber Security Checklist Important for Insurance Organizations?

Insurance organizations must protect sensitive customer data, such as Social Security numbers, health information, and financial information. With the increasing number of cyber threats, insurance organizations must ensure that their systems are secure and that their networks are protected from malicious activities. A cyber security checklist helps insurance organizations to identify any potential vulnerabilities and monitor their security posture on an ongoing basis. By doing so, insurance organizations can protect their customers’ data and assets from potential cyber threats.

What Should Be Included in a Cyber Security Checklist?

A comprehensive cyber security checklist should include the following components:

  • Network Security: This includes measures such as firewalls, access control, and virus protection.
  • Data Security: This includes measures such as encryption, data backups, and data storage.
  • User Access Controls: This includes measures such as authentication, user roles, and user rights.
  • Vulnerability Management: This includes measures such as vulnerability scanning and patching.
  • Incident Response: This includes measures such as a response plan, response team, and response training.
